Grandfather’s Gold Wedding Band on a Gold Chain Found After Being Lost on North Topsail, NC Beach

Jon’s family arrived for a few days vacation and spent the morning enjoying the beach, waves, and weather. Jon took off his necklace, which held his late grandfather’s wedding band, and placed it on his lap. It wasn’t until they returned to their room that Jon realized his necklace was missing. That evening, Jon’s wife made a social media post hoping for its return, but I felt she revealed too much information about its location. I came across her post, sent her a private message, and reached out to her after some detective work. We connected quickly, and I headed to North Topsail Beach. Despite doubts about finding the necklace after 12 hours, I met Jon, who described the events of the day before heading back to his room. I began my search, and after a few passes, my machine picked up a non-ferrous signal. Using my pinpointer, I located the target, scooped into the sand, and uncovered the gold chain, pulling it from its sandy hiding spot.

Two Very Important Lost Rings Found After Kids Day At The Beach

I was taking advantage of the calm Atlantic Ocean waves by metal detecting the waist deep waters of Emerald Isle, NC.  My phone, in it’s waterproof case, rang and I came out of the water to return the call.  Jeff informed me his wife Kim had lost 2 of her rings on the beach about an hour away from my current location.  I told Jeff I would load up the truck and head that way as soon as possible.

Upon arrival, Kim & Jeff informed me she was spending the day at the beach and removed her rings to apply sunscreen to the kids.  She became distracted and wasn’t sure where she placed them but feels they were on the beach blanket.  It wasn’t until she returned home to shower that she noticed her rings were missing.  Kim went back to the location and tried to search and found the area (because of a dead crab nearby).   Kim was unable to dig out the rings from the sand.  Marking the location was very important as I started to grid search the area and after one pass, I turned to start a second search line, and my metal detector sounded off very loudly.  I looked up at Jeff & Kim and smiled.  I was almost certain I had found them under the sand.  My pinpointer confirmed the location and I used my hand to scoop the rings to the surface.   Kim came a running after spotting the large cigar style ring.
